Fitness Tracking Apps Raise Singapore Military Security Concerns
The routine use of fitness tracking apps like Strava in Singapore's military bases is raising security concerns. Experts say the apps can reveal daily routines and movement patterns of personnel.

Singapore March Retail Sales Grow To 4.7 Billion Dollars
Retail sales in Singapore grew 4.8% year-on-year in March. This represents a slowdown from the 8.3% growth recorded in February. The data was released by the Department of Statistics. Growth in the sector has slowed as post-festive spending eases. The slowdown occurs amid rising inflation, slowing growth, and tensions in the Middle East. Singapore's retail sales reached 4.7 billion Singapore dollars in March. Analysts noted the growth follows the conclusion of Chinese New Year festivities. The data is currently within market expectations and does not yet reflect the full impact of ongoing Middle East conflict on consumer spending. Most consumer segments maintained record gains despite the slower pace.

Singapore Agencies Alerted Over Claude Mythos AI
Government agencies and banks in Singapore are on heightened alert regarding frontier AI models, specifically Claude Mythos. This advanced technology is reportedly capable of detecting unknown flaws in digital systems and exploiting them at speeds. The Monetary Authority of Singapore has convened leaders from major financial institutions to discuss these emerging threats. Owners of all critical information infrastructure have been notified of the potential risks.
